Banor Posted February 5, 2007 Posted February 5, 2007 I own / have owned 9 Airrus rods (2 are swimming with the fish). These rods are very sensitive, very affordable and the owner is the guy you order from. Personable service and a great guy who backs his work with a warranty and genuine interest in pleasing his customers. I'm not a rep or pro staffer or anything (would like to be) so you can take this as one angler's experienced opinion. I have used all of these rods for an entire season and have not had a single malfunction or broken part at all. (if you dont count my wife rolling the Jeep window up and snapping the tip) I only have two problems with Airrus rods. First is that Ken has a hard time keeping the popular size/power/action in the Warehouse!! They sell like hotcakes. Second, there isnt as much range of power/action combinations as I would for my personal specialization. Other than that I give them 2 thumbs up. B Quote

R Tilson Posted February 10, 2007 Posted February 10, 2007 Without a doubt a great rod. All my pitching / flipping rods are 7'-6" Ultra XL Hvy and XHvy models. Very stiff for making long pitches and hauling out big fish yet sensitive enough to feel the fish breeth on your bait. 7'-0" Co-Matrix Hvy for frogs (castability) and 7'-0" XHvy for Stickbaits. I've started playing around with the spinning rods this year (Ultra XL). Been testing the 7'-6" & 7'-0" Med Hvy with finessee jigs and like the sensitivity as well as the action. Can't say enough about Ken. Stand up guy that holds to his word. Quote
